Allgäu Bergkäse master class - 200-year cheese tradition meets wine pairing

Josef Aurel Stadler brought Swiss cheesemaking to Allgäu in 1821, revolutionizing the region from butter production to the hard mountain cheese that defines it today. Visit Schlappoldalpe dairy above Oberstdorf to see Bergkäse made by hand, then pair aged wheels with Austrian Grauburgunder and Gewürztraminer - the fat-acid-aroma interplay that only works with alpine cheese.
